Ministry In The Image Of God
By Stephen Seamands
Reviewed On: March 01, 2006

As ministers driven by the day-to-day demands of church life, it is easy for us to focus almost exclusively on the pragmatic side of ministry, to the exclusion of thinking theologically about what we do. Ministry In The Image Of God (InterVarsity Press) by Stephen Seamands helps us think more deeply about what we do and why we do it, rooting the practice of ministry in Trinitarian thought. As the author asserts, "Having spent eleven years as a local church pastor and more than twenty years as a seminary professor of theology who equips persons preparing for Christian service, I am convinced that no doctrine is, in fact, more relevant to our identity and calling as ministers than the Trinity."
